Transaction 8759109383fbe1d51d0d6828591bcc110e8af333349222251b28ff544e890c33

1 Input
2 Outputs
  • 8759109383fbe1d51d0d6828591bcc110e8af333349222251b28ff544e890c33:0
  • value  1387
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 8759109383fbe1d51d0d6828591bcc110e8af333349222251b28ff544e890c33:1
  • value  24878
    address  1F1ZywHocwMGnApb3gCi3yAdhhU3x3zfLm